Q: Is 21,550,502 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 21,550,502 is not a prime number.

Why is 21,550,502 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 21550502 can be evenly divided by 1 2 37 41 74 82 1,517 3,034 7,103 14,206 262,811 291,223 525,622 582,446 10,775,251 and 21,550,502, with no remainder.

Since 21,550,502 cannot be divided by just 1 and 21,550,502, it is not a prime number.
